data plan not active on transferred service

I realize taking my phone into Sprint will probably be my best option, but with the holidays amok.. I'm not really looking forward to that. So I'll try to ask here in hopes that it might be a simple fix.

I have an HTC Touch Diamond. I cracked the screen on it and got the insurance company to send me a new phone. I called earlier and switched the service over to the new Diamond. I can now call and text people from the new phone.. but the data plan does not appear to have switched. I cannot download my email, surf the web, or send picture mail. I do have the plan on my bill and it worked fine before today.

When I look at ##data#, there is no user name.. and the phone is not assigned an IP. I have the MSL for the new phone, and I tried to change the ##data# settings to match the old phone. I was able to change the user name, but the IP addresses, even with the MSL, are still unable to be changed. When that didn't work, I just switched it back to how it was before I started.

First off.. I transferred my plan about 4 hours ago. I had to manually change the MDN and MSID to my phone number because it did not happen automatically through some "hands free" nonsense that was supposed to happen. The rep I spoke with told me everything should be set to go in about an hour, but it's not. I tried calling again, but now they're closed for the holidays.

So.. is there simply something else I need to do to the phone in order to get the data plan working? Something maybe similar to what I had to do when manually changing the MDN and MSID to my phone number?
